President Zoran Milanović reacted on Facebook to an interview given by Nova left MP Rada Borić for Jutarnji list and directed a series of criticisms at her. In addition to Ms. Boric, the President of the Republic sharply attacked Jutarnji list, as well as the leader of the coalition We Can! Tomislav Tomašević .
We transmit his status in full.
- The Member of the Croatian Parliament, Ms. Rada Borić, the former president of the New Left, logically and appropriately chose "Jutarnji list" for her untruths and dishonesty. These are, let me remind you, a daily newspaper that ended up in the clutches of a law firm a few years ago that is completely uninterested in journalism and any public interest, but is very interested in its political and economic influence. Fine, by God.
Ms. Boric is not telling the truth when she says "that she supported me and voted for me." It may be, of course, that she voted for me in secret at the polling station, but at the public level - she was and is a member and even a leader of Kabbalah who slandered and obstructed me wherever she was and however she arrived during the campaign and before the campaign, as well as during those years that I did not spend in public activity.
Ms. Boric only got stuck in the second round of the presidential election, like some other honest people, after my, unclear to her, victory in the first round. She came to that beautiful and energetic gathering at the Boćarski dom in Zagreb and pushed herself into the staff, true, in agreement with the organizers of the gathering. "Political freeloading of sorts," they would say in DC. More precisely - bandwagoning. She enlisted in the Partisans in May 1945. Even then, in the battles for Rijeka and Istria, they died, but she was not spotted there.
Ms. Boric, therefore, is falsely portrayed. I won the election despite her and others like her. I didn't want to pay any attention to that later and I intended to leave everything to oblivion, but it turned out that fate wanted something different.
In the July 2020 elections, Ms. Boric won a parliamentary seat. Four thousand two hundred and three preferential votes. Not at all impressive, especially for someone who has been publicly arguing with everyone for decades and 'coldly allows herself to be portrayed as' the seventh most influential feminist in the world' and 'scientist'. But I have already said that we are not dealing here with a lover of truth and facts.
Such a person, now I come to the occasion of this record, asks the recently elected President of the Republic, that is, me, to - resign. No less and no more than to back off! But why?
Here Ms. Borić once again paints all the beauties and overflows of her revolutionary morality and honesty. He does not say a word about the outburst of a member of parliament in which he calls "criminals and prostitutes" people who have in common the "genus proximus" that they have found themselves in the same space, often in the company of contemporary academics, world-renowned artists and real scientists. Neither the letters nor the review of the scientist Borić on this book example of gender stereotyping, sexism and slander. Nothing to anyone.

Ms. Boric, you came to my office about two months ago and we talked about the need to pass the Zagreb Reconstruction Act quickly. Why did you even come to the office of the president whom, some sixty days later, as if the criminal had been caught violating the rules of parole, you were able, in the manner of revolutionary justice, to call for his removal from office? Where did you learn that, Ms. Boric? In Finland?
Leaders of the failed Scandinavian social democracies (both sexes represented), especially the Danish and Swedish, with whom I had the good fortune and opportunity to discuss the issues of "faith" for years at a time and because of my personality, were always terrified of archetypal and complacent leftists. who consider everything but themselves to be heretics and a "counter-revolution." They saw them as the most serious obstacle to entering the desired "open society". The extreme right was then on the margins.
A word or two about Mr. Tomislav Tomašević , it is true, a much less incorrect politician. Wannabe-Mayor also has time to name me and share lessons with me for "inappropriate" behavior, but he is silent about the verbal savagery of a member of Parliament. What does the term "inappropriate" mean in the jargon of your "club", Mr. Tomasevic? Is it a prelude to a fatwa or just a friendly critique?
If this is the latter, it does not seem appropriate to me that you and many others come to the Parliament dressed as they used to go to the teferic in Ilidža. No suit, no tie, like you’re bigger than the institution you belong to. You think I'm wearing a suit and tie?
You wonder - why this analogy now? Well, let me just show you how useless content can fill the space, just as in the case of your comment on my words and actions.
I have been living and leading Croatian politics for fifteen years. In those fifteen years I have had no serious difficulty in working with and in favor of minorities of all colors and provenances. This cannot be erased or thwarted by any and anyone's battle cries and vain interviews in the tabloids, especially not yours, Ms. Boric and Mr. Tomasevic.
"I don't care, guys, about your commercials, others passed by you before you." (BJ Štulić: "A city without love")
Is this also "inappropriate"? - Milanović wrote on Facebook.
